So for solvent soaking. All you do is get a patch wet run it down the barrel and then wait 10 - 30 mins. I use the TC17 foam. I spray it in there and let it work. Then work on the breech plug get it all cleared out and then let it soak in the TC17 solvent. Then go back to the barrel and receiver. Finish cleaning them up and then back to the breech plug. Works for me and everything comes out cleaner then ever. Patches come out pure white. Actually my Triumph is the cleanest rifle.
